For the first time since 1991, the Green Bay Packers (5-8-1, 1-3-1 NFC North) will have back-to-back losing seasons after falling to the Chicago Bears (10-4, 4-1 NFC North) 24-17 Sunday. With the win, the Bears clinch the NFC North Division for the first time since 2010 and officially eliminated the Packers from playoff contention.
